Chapter 7: Advanced Features
7.21.10

Using the PL Defeat Feature

This feature allows you to override any coded squelch programmed to a channel. Your radio also unmutes
any digital activity on a digital channel. When this feature is active, the Carrier Squelch status indicator is
displayed.
Procedure:
Place the programmed PL Defeat switch in the PL Defeat position.
One of the following indications occurs :
Your radio plays the active transmission on the channel.
If no activity is present, your radio is muted.
7.21.11

Digital PTT ID Support

This feature allows you to see the radio ID (number) of the radio from whom you are currently receiving a
transmission. The receiving radio and the dispatcher can view the ID, which consists of up to a maximum of
eight characters.
The ID number of your radio is also automatically sent every time you press the PTT button. This feature is
programmed per channel. For digital voice transmissions, the ID of your radio is sent continuously during the
voice message.
7.21.12

Smart PTT (Conventional Only)

Smart PTT is a per-personality, programmable feature used to keep radio users from talking over other radio
conversations. When Smart PTT is enabled in your radio, you cannot transmit on an active channel.
The following table shows the variations of Smart PTT.
Mode
Transmit Inhibit on Busy Channel with Carrier
Transmit Inhibit on Busy Channel with Wrong
Squelch Code
Quick-Key Override
76
Description
You cannot transmit if traffic is detected on the
channel.
You cannot transmit on an active channel with a
squelch code or (if secure-equipped) encryption
key other than your own. If the PL code is the
same as yours, the transmission is not prevented.
Your radio must be programmed to allow you to
use Quick-Key Override. This feature works with
either one of the two above variations. You can
override the transmit-inhibit state by quick-keying
the radio (press PTT button twice within the pro-
grammed time limit).
